Note: The general rule of thumb for amount of baking powder in recipes: 1 to 2 teaspoons ( 5-10 grams) of baking powder leavens 1 cup (140 grams) of flour. The amount will depend on the ingredients and how they are mixed.
Web30 jun. 2024 · The following nutrition information is provided by the USDA for 1 teaspoon (4.6g) of double-acting baking powder. 1 Baking Powder Nutrition Facts Calories: 2.4 Fat: 0g Sodium: 363mg Carbohydrates: 1.1g Fiber: 0g Sugars: 0g Protein: 0g Carbs Baking powder has 2.4 calories and just over 1 gram of carbs in one teaspoon.
